The Company are seeking key individuals to join the existing test teams engaged in the production of advanced electronics systems and integrated end to end RF & microwave solutions for the Defence, Space and Security markets.

Purpose of the role:

To take outline design information and applying practical methods and theory, transform it into a design fit for purpose using Altium (Electronic Design Software).

To carry out analogue / digital / RF design from concept to final PCB layout.

To manage the outsourcing of designs to external subcontractors if required.

Working closely with the Electronic & RF Design Engineers to achieve the correct engineering solution for the design requirements.

Key Responsibilities:

  • To work as part of a design team taking responsibility for the circuit design
  • To provide data packages for the development of new products through to production in conjunction with timescales set by the program / production
  • To ensure a high quality of accurate layouts are created by thoroughly checking own work and that of others (Engineers)
  • To continuously develop and improve product development
  • Ensure that all TD procedures are followed
  • Customer and Supplier liaison

Job Content:

  • To produce PCB layout's from Engineering requirements to IPC Standards using Altium
  • To continuously develop and improve PCB product development process
  • Create library parts from component data sheets and maintain library database
  • Ensure that all PCB designs are delivered on time and to planned cost
  • To aid mechanical verification and for new and existing products
  • To ensure design for manufacture is applied throughout the project
  • Consider cost implications of designs and processes ensuring that products can be manufactured in the most cost effective manner
  • To design, produce and update Manufacturing Data Package ensuring that products are suitable for production
  • To attend and contribute to design, project and process improvement meetings
  • To apply IPC standards and engineering best practice to design products for manufacturing, questioning design standards by suggesting cost effective, easier and improved solutions
  • Work with the Board Manufacturers and Board Assemblers during the development and manufacturing phases
  • Prepare documentation for and attend design reviews
  • Ensure procedures for the creation, storage and distribution of data are followed
  • To react to change notes from Configuration Control, updating layouts in accordance with data provided and amending errors of own and others
  • Foster and maintain good Customer and Supplier relations
  • Ensure the part creation of all components relating to the circuit design
